Join us on Wednesday, June 25, from noon to 1 p.m. ET for our next USPTO Hour, hosted by the Office of the Commissioner for Trademarks.

In this session, we'll focus on our efforts to protect the trademark register from suspicious filings and fraudulent submissions. The topics will include:

  • Clearing the inventory of invalid applications and registrations
  • Increasing efficiencies in filing and case management
  • Dealing with improper signatures in trademark filings
  • Preventing application and attorney credential hijacking

We'll also follow up on questions raised during April's USPTO Hour on trademark pendency and preventing fraudulent filings.

The discussion will feature agency experts, including:

  • Amy Cotton, Deputy Commissioner for Trademark Examination Policy
  • Sarah Kunkleman, Supervisory Attorney Advisor, Register Protection Office
  • Matt Schwab, Senior Legal Administrator for Trademarks Technology and Systems
